在社交媒体应用程序的主页中实现无限滚动,可以通过使用React.js来实现。React.js是一个用于构建用户界面的JavaScript库,它可以帮助我们构建高效、可重用的UI组件。
实现无限滚动的一种常见方法是使用分页加载(pagination)的方式。具体步骤如下:
这样,当用户滚动到页面底部时,新的数据将被加载并显示在页面上,实现了无限滚动效果。
React.js在实现无限滚动时有许多优势,包括:
在腾讯云的产品中,可以使用腾讯云的云函数(Serverless Cloud Function)来实现后端API的开发和部署。云函数可以提供弹性的计算能力,支持各种编程语言和框架。
此外,腾讯云的对象存储(COS)可以用于存储和管理媒体文件,例如图片、视频等。可以将加载的媒体文件存储在COS中,并通过腾讯云的CDN加速服务来提供快速的内容分发。
总结起来,使用React.js在社交媒体应用程序的主页中实现无限滚动,可以通过分页加载的方式,结合腾讯云的云函数和对象存储等产品来实现。这样可以提供高效、可扩展的用户体验,并且能够满足大规模数据处理和存储的需求。
参考链接:
云+社区技术沙龙[第6期]
企业创新在线学堂
新知
云+社区技术沙龙[第8期]
腾讯云“智能+互联网TechDay”
第五届Techo TVP开发者峰会
第四期Techo TVP开发者峰会
领取专属 10元无门槛券
手把手带您无忧上云